Народ, ! язык free pascal 1) найти сумму всех трехзначных чисел кратных трем. 2) вывести все двузначные нечетные числа в столбец. например: 10 12

linaangel20012 linaangel20012    2   15.09.2019 08:40    0

Ответы
samudoma2006 samudoma2006  07.10.2020 16:39
1)
Program n1;
var i: integer;
sum: real;
begin
sum:=0;
for i:=102 to 1000 do if (i mod 3=0) then sum:=sum+i;
writeln('Сумма: ',sum);
end.
2)
Program n2;
var i: integer;
begin
for i:=10 to 99 do if (i mod 2<>0)then writeln(i);
end.
ПОКАЗАТЬ ОТВЕТЫ
alionka7 alionka7  07.10.2020 16:39
Program prog1;
var i: integer;sum: real;
begin
sum:=0;
repeat 
i:=i+1;
 if (i mod 3=0) then sum:=sum+i;
 until (i>100) and (i<1000);
writeln('Сумма= ',sum);
end.
2)
Program prog2;
var i: integer;
begin
i:=10;
repeat
i:=i+1;
 if (i mod 2<>0)then writeln(i);
 until i>=100;
end.
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ика